Endobronchial metastasis secondary to renal clear cell carcinoma:A case report

BACKGROUND Endobronchial metastases(EBMs)are tumours that metastasise from a malignant tumour outside the lungs to the central and subsegmental bronchi,and are visible under a bronchofibrescope.Most EBMs are formed by direct invasion or metastasis of intrathoracic malignant tumours,such as lung cancer,oesophageal cancer or mediastinum tumours.Renal cell carcinoma(RCC),accounting for 2%to 3%of all tumours,is a common malignant tumour of the urinary system.Renal clear cell carcinoma(RCCC)constitutes the predominant pathological subtype of RCC,comprising approximately 70%to 80%of all RCC cases.RCCC can spread and metastasise through arterial,venous and lymphatic circulation to almost all organs of the body.Moreover,lung,bone,liver,brain and local recurrence are the most common metastatic neoplasms of RCCC.However,EBM from RCCC has a low complication rate and is often misdiagnosed as primary lung cancer.CASE SUMMARY A 71-year-old male patient who had undergone radical left nephrectomy 7 years prior due to RCCC was referred to our hospital due to a 1-mo history of productive cough.The results of an enhanced chest CT scan indicated the presence of a soft tissue nodule in the upper lobe of the left lung,and flexible bronchoscopy revealed a hypervascular lesion in the bronchus of the left lung's superior lobe.Therefore,the patient underwent thoracoscopic left superior lobe wedge resection,and pathology confirmed EBM from the RCCC.CONCLUSION EBM from RCCC has a low incidence and no characteristic clinical manifestations in the early stage.If a bronchial tumour is found in a patient with RCCC,the possibility of bronchial metastatic cancer should be considered. 展开更多

Pembrolizumab combined with axitinib in the treatment of skin metastasis of renal clear cell carcinoma to nasal ala:A case report

BACKGROUND Renal clear cell carcinoma(RCC)is a malignant tumor of the genitourinary system with a predilection for males.The most common metastatic sites are the lung,liver,lymph nodes,contralateral kidney or adrenal gland,however,skin metastasis has only been seen in 1.0%-3.3%of cases.The most common site of skin metastasis is the scalp,and metastasis to the nasal ala region is rare.CASE SUMMARY A 55-year-old man with clear cell carcinoma of the left kidney was treated with pembrolizumab and axitinib for half a year after surgery and was found to have a red mass on his right nasal ala for 3 mo.The skin lesion of the patient grew rapidly to the size of 2.0 cm×2.0 cm×1.2 cm after discontinuation of targeted drug therapy due to the coronavirus disease 2019 epidemic.The patient was finally diagnosed with skin metastasis of RCC in our hospital.The patient refused to undergo surgical resection and the tumor shrank rapidly after resuming target therapy for 2 wk.CONCLUSION It is rare for an RCC to metastasize to the skin of the nasal ala region.The tumor size change of this patient before and after treatment with targeted drugs shows the effectiveness of combination therapy for skin metastasis. 展开更多

Iris metastasis from clear cell renal cell carcinoma: A case report

BACKGROUND Clear cell renal cell carcinoma(ccRCC)is a common type of tumor that can metastasize to any organs and sites.However,it is extremely rare for ccRCC to metastasize to the iris.Here,we describe a rare case of iris metastasis from ccRCC with a history of left nephrectomy in 2010.CASE SUMMARY A 62-year-old male was admitted to the hospital due to blurred vision and red eyes,and a mass was found on the iris in the right eye.B-scan ultrasonography revealed a well-bounded high-density lesion at the corner of the anterior chamber at the 3-4 o’clock position.Phacoemulsification with simultaneous intraocular lens implantation and iridocyclectomy was performed in the right eye.The lesion was confirmed to be metastatic ccRCC by histological and immunohistochemical analyses.The patient was still alive at 9 mo after surgical treatment.Ocular metastasis can be an initial sign with a poor prognosis.Timely detection and treatment may improve survival.Clinicians should pay attention to similar metastatic diseases to prevent misdiagnosis leading to missed treatment oppor-tunities.CONCLUSION This report of the characteristics and successful management of a rare case of iris metastasis from ccRCC highlights the importance of a comprehensive medical history,histopathology,immunohistochemistry,and clinical manifestation for successful disease diagnosis. 展开更多

Objective:Clear cell renal cell carcinoma(ccRCC)is the most common subtype of renal cell carcinoma(RCC)and is characterized by biallelic inactivation of the von Hippel-Lindau(VHL)tumor suppressor gene.One effect of VH... Objective:Clear cell renal cell carcinoma(ccRCC)is the most common subtype of renal cell carcinoma(RCC)and is characterized by biallelic inactivation of the von Hippel-Lindau(VHL)tumor suppressor gene.One effect of VHL inactivation is hypoxia inducible factor alpha(HIFa)-independent constitutive activation of nuclear factor kappa B(NF-κB)and c-jun N-terminal kinase(JNK).Both NF-κB and JNK drive ccRCC growth and epithelial to mesenchymal transition(EMT).The purpose of this study was to determine the biochemical effects of pomegranate juice extracts(PE)on RCC cell lines.Methods:The pre-clinical effects of PE on NF-κB,JNK,and the EMT phenotype were assayed,including its effect on proliferation,anchorage-independent growth,and invasion of pVHLdeficient RCCs.Results:PE inhibits the NF-κB and JNK pathways and consequently inhibits the EMT phenotype of pVHL-deficient ccRCCs.The effects of PE are concentration-dependent and affect not only biochemical markers of EMT(i.e.,cadherin expression)but also functional manifestations of EMT,such as invasion.These effects are manifested within days of exposure to PE when diluted 2000-fold.Highly dilute concentrations of PE(106 dilution),which do not impact these pathways in the short term,were found to have NF-κB and JNK inhibitory effects and ability to reverse the EMT phenotype following prolonged exposure.Conclusion:These findings suggest that PE may mediate inhibition growth of pVHL-deficient ccRCCs and raises the possibility of its use as a dietary adjunct to managing patients with active surveillance for small,localized,incidentally identified renal tumors so as to avoid more invasive procedures such as nephrectomy. 展开更多

Tumor-to-tumor metastasis of clear cell renal cell carcinoma to contralateral synchronous pheochromocytoma:A case report

BACKGROUND Tumor-to-tumor metastasis(TTM)is an uncommon condition.Only a few cases of renal cell carcinoma(RCC)as donor tumor of TTM have been reported in literature,and none of these studies have described RCC metastasizing to synchronous pheochromocytoma(PCC).CASE SUMMARY The patient was a 54-year-old woman who presented with recurrent dull abdominal pain for six months,which was further aggravated for one more month.Enhanced computed tomography revealed a tumor mass in the right kidney and another mass in the left retroperitoneum/adrenal gland.Histopathology and immunochemistry of resected specimens confirmed the diagnosis of clear cell renal cell carcinoma(CCRCC)of the right kidney,and the left retroperitoneum revealed a typical PCC with CCRCC metastasis.Whole exome sequencing revealed the presence of a c.529A>T somatic mutation of the Von Hippel Lindau(VHL)gene in the metastasized CCRCC,which was also present in the primary right kidney CCRCC,as confirmed by Sanger sequencing.No VHL mutation was detected in the PCC or in normal right kidney tissue.Fluorescence in situ hybridization revealed loss of chromosome 3p in both the primary right kidney CCRCC and CCRCC metastasized to PCC in the left kidney.CONCLUSION This is the first case showing metastasis of CCRCC to PCC,thus leading to tumorto-tumor metastasis. 展开更多

Decreased cross-sectional muscle area in male patients with clear cell renal cell carcinoma and peritumoral collateral vessels

BACKGROUND Sarcopenia is the loss of skeletal muscle mass(SMM)and is a sign of cancer cachexia.Patients with advanced renal cell carcinoma(RCC)may show cachexia.AIM To evaluate the amount of SMM in male clear cell RCC(ccRCC)patients with and without collateral vessels.METHODS In this study,we included a total of 124 male Caucasian patients divided into two groups:ccRCCa group without collateral vessels(n=54)and ccRCCp group with collateral vessels(n=70).Total abdominal muscle area(TAMA)was measured in both groups using a computed tomography imaging-based approach.TAMA measures were also corrected for age in order to rule out age-related effects.RESULTS There was a statistically significant difference between the two groups in terms of TAMA(P<0.05)driven by a reduction in patients with peritumoral collateral vessels.The result was confirmed by repeating the analysis with values corrected for age(P<0.05),indicating no age effect on our findings.CONCLUSION This study showed a decreased TAMA in ccRCC patients with peritumoral collateral vessels.The presence of peritumoral collateral vessels adjacent to ccRCC might be a fine diagnostic clue to sarcopenia. 展开更多
